You may lose the esteem or respect from certain coll agues because of the nature of GRILL FLAME activities since some may consider participation in such activities as indicating a belief in the "occult or magical." To our knowledge, no-one has suffered such career damage from a GRILL FLAME-related activity, but the potential for such is brought to your attention. 8. 1 understand that as a participant iri the GRILL FLAM program, I may come to believe that I have the ability to use "psychic power " for personal pro- fit in risk-taking situations such as "games of chance" r speculative invest- ment. Any such assumption on my part is my sole responsibility. The GRILL FLAME program in no way sanctions such an assumption. S Pie individuals who have served as subjects in this kind of experiment have c e on such assumptions to their apparent disadvantage. Thus, the risk exists that you may come to believe that you have a power that you do not possess. You are advised of this risk and warned that you assume responsibility for any assumptions which you make about your personal powers or capabilities answers 9.
